Instructions
- Bring a pot of water to a boil and cook the buldak carbonara noodles for 5 minutes.
- In a separate bowl, combine the sauce ingredients: mix thoroughly to combine the toasted sesame oil, egg yolks, noodle seasoning packets, and Kewpie mayonnaise.
- Carefully incorporate a few spoonfuls of the boiling noodle water into the sauce mixture, stirring quickly to ensure the egg yolks do not cook.
- Continue stirring until the sauce achieves a smooth and creamy consistency.
- Drain the noodles and incorporate them into the sauce mixture.
- Stir until the noodles are thoroughly coated with the sauce.
- Serve with sliced green onions, a sprinkle of furikake, and grated Parmesan on top to enhance the flavor.
